Overview
The 2008 Harley-Davidson Touring Models Service Manual is an essential resource for motorcycle enthusiasts and professional technicians alike. This comprehensive guide covers the intricate details of maintenance, repairs, and servicing for all 2008 Touring Models, allowing you to keep your bike running smoothly with confidence. This manual combines both basic maintenance tips and advanced servicing knowledge, ensuring that both novice and experienced mechanics can benefit.
What's Inside
This manual contains an extensive Table of Contents, including:
- General Maintenance Guidelines: Pre-ride inspections, routine checks, and seasonal considerations to ensure your motorcycle is safe and reliable.
- Lubrication Guidelines: Detailed instructions on different types of lubrications including engine oil, primary chaincase, and transmission fluid.
- Brake System Maintenance: Step-by-step guidance on inspecting and replacing brake pads and discs, including procedures for bleeding brakes and ensuring optimal performance.
- Electrical Diagnostics: Troubleshooting techniques for electrical components, including battery maintenance and care for sensors and indicators.
- Air Cleaner and Exhaust Inspection: Instructions on maintaining air filters and checking exhaust systems for leaks.
- Troubleshooting: Comprehensive troubleshooting section that assists in diagnosing mechanical and electrical issues based on symptoms.
This manual is structured logically with clear headings and detailed illustrations to guide you through the procedures. Recommended tools and safety precautions are highlighted throughout the text, making complex tasks manageable even for less experienced users.
